This position serves as the strategic owner of critical core technology products, driving the full hardware product development lifecycle from concept through sustainment. You will lead a cross-functional engineering team spanning Electrical, Firmware, FPGA, and Test disciplines to deliver robust embedded compute solutions for vehicle management, digital signal processing, and networking. The role exists to define and execute the product portfolio and roadmap, ensuring scalable deployment of high-performance PCBs, including host boards for FPGAs, SoCs, and SoMs.
In this capacity, you will establish and optimize comprehensive product development workflows and best practices across architecture, design, simulation, verification, and system testing. Success requires extensive collaboration with internal stakeholders, product management, and customers to align on requirements and strategic roadmaps. You will manage detailed schedules and milestones, ensuring clear task assignments and accountability within the team to deliver complex hardware solutions on time.
